The third member of The Trinity, God The
Holy Spirit, as a person, is shown to have the following
characteristics.
Psalm 51:11 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, reverenced.)
Cast me not away from thy presence;
and take not thy Holy spirit from me.
Matthew 12:31 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, may be blasphemed, reviled.)
Wherefore I say unto you, All manner
of sin and blasphemy shall be forgiven unto men: but the blasphemy
against The Holy Ghost shall not be forgiven unto men.
John 6:63 NKJV (The Holy Spirit,
Life giving.)
It is The Spirit who gives life; the
flesh profits nothing. The words that I speak to you are Spirit, and
they are Life.
John 14:16 KJV (The Holy Spirit,
who comforts us.)
And I will pray The Father, and He
shall give you another Comforter, that He may abide with you for
ever;
John 14:17 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, is The Spirit Of Truth.)
Even The Spirit Of Truth; whom the
world cannot receive, because it seeth Him not, neither knoweth Him:
but ye know Him; for He dwelleth with you, and shall be in you.
John 14:26 KJV
(The Holy Spirit, teaches us.)
But The Comforter, which is The Holy
Ghost, whom The Father will send in My name, He shall teach you all
things, and bring all things to your remembrance, whatsoever I have
said unto you.
John 15:26 NLT
(The Holy Spirit, testifies of The Truth.)
But I will send you The Advocate
(The Comforter)—The Spirit Of Truth. He will come to you from The
Father and will testify all about Me
John 16:12-14
KJV (The Holy Spirit, guide, teacher, one who glorifies The Lord.)
12 I have yet many things to say
unto you, but ye cannot bear them now.
13 Howbeit when he, The Spirit Of
Truth, is come, He will guide you into all Truth: for He shall not
speak of Himself; but whatsoever He shall hear, that shall He speak:
and He will shew you things to come.
14 He shall glorify Me: for He shall
receive of Mine, and shall shew it unto you.
Acts 5:3 KJV (The Holy spirit, may be lied to.)
But Peter said, Ananias, why hath
Satan filled thine heart to lie to The Holy Ghost, and to keep back
part of the price of the land?
Acts 7:51 KJV (The Holy Spirit,
may be resisted.)
Ye stiff necked and uncircumcised in
heart and ears, ye do always resist The Holy Ghost: as your fathers
did, so do ye.
Acts 10:19,20 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, guides us.)
19 Meanwhile, as Peter was puzzling
over the vision, The Holy Spirit said to him, “Three men have come
looking for you.
20 Get up, go downstairs, and go
with them without hesitation. Don’t worry, for I have sent them.”
Acts 16:6-8 NLT
(The Holy Spirit, warns.)
6 Next Paul and Silas traveled
through the area of Phrygia and Galatia, because
The Holy Spirit had prevented them
from preaching The Word in the province of Asia at that time.
7 Then coming to the borders of
Mysia, they headed north for the province of Bithynia, but again The
Spirit Of Jesus did not allow them to go there.
8 So instead, they went on through
Mysia to the seaport of Troas.
Romans 8:2 NLT (The Holy Spirit,
gives Life.)
And because you belong to Him, the
power of the Life-giving Spirit has freed you from the power of sin
that leads to death.
Romans 8:15 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, adopts us into the family of God.)
For ye have not received the spirit
of bondage again to fear; but ye have received The Spirit Of
Adoption, whereby we cry, Abba, Father.
Romans 8:26 NKJV The Holy
Spirit, intercedes.)
Likewise The Spirit also helps in
our weaknesses. For we do not know what we should pray for as we
ought, but The Spirit Himself makes intercession for us with
groanings which cannot be uttered.
Romans 8:27 KJV (The Holy
Spirit's mind-thoughts.)
And He that searcheth the hearts
knoweth what is the mind of The Spirit, because He maketh
intercession for the saints according to the will of God.
Romans 15:30 NKJV (The Holy
Spirit, is a God of love.)
Now I beg you, brethren, through the
Lord Jesus Christ, and through the love of
The Spirit, that you strive together
with me in prayers to God for me,
I Corinthians 2:11 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, knows man. and God.)
For what man knoweth the things of a
man, save the spirit of man which is in him? even so the things of
God knoweth no man, but The Spirit Of God.
I Corinthians 12:11 NLT (The
Holy Spirit, wills what gifts, we have.)
It is the one and only Spirit who
distributes all these gifts. He alone decides which gift each person
should have.
Ephesians 4:30 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, may be grieved.)
And grieve not The Holy Spirit Of
God, whereby ye are sealed unto the day of redemption.
Titus 3:4,5 KJV (The Holy
Spirit, gives spiritual rebirth, to God's people.)
4 But—When God our Savior revealed
His kindness and love,
5 He saved us, not because of the
righteous things we had done, but because of His mercy. He washed
away our sins, giving us a new birth and new Life through
The Holy Spirit.
Hebrews 10:28,29 KJV The Holy
Spirit, may be insulted.)
28 He that despised Moses' law died
without mercy under two or three witnesses:
29 Of how much sorer punishment,
suppose ye, shall he be thought worthy, who hath trodden under foot
The Son Of God, and hath counted The Blood Of The Covenant, wherewith
he was sanctified, an unholy thing, and hath done despite (Insult)
unto
The Spirit Of Grace?
I Peter 1:2 NKJV (The Holy
Spirit, changes us into the image of Jesus Christ.)
Elect according to the foreknowledge
of God The Father, in sanctification (growing in grace) of The
Spirit, for obedience and sprinkling of The Blood Of Jesus Christ:
